BitShares Forum

Other => Graveyard => MemoryCoin => Topic started by: FreeTrade on December 24, 2013, 07:38:28 pm

Title: v0.8.55 - Faster Startup
Post by: FreeTrade on December 24, 2013, 07:38:28 pm
New version available.

Windows Binaries and github source updated.

The main change is faster startup, reindex and better performance - previous hashes are cached so hashing is only ever performed once for a block.

v0.8.55
http://www.memorycoin.org/downloads/memorycoin.zip
https://drive.google.com/file/d/0B-5Ax5kejTpMRzgwTEFBRjBjTFU/edit?usp=sharing
Title: Re: v0.8.55 - Faster Startup
Post by: I_M on December 24, 2013, 07:48:33 pm
This is much better!  Startup was practically instantaneous!  Thanks!
Title: Re: v0.8.55 - Faster Startup
Post by: agran on December 24, 2013, 08:02:16 pm
Very cool! Incredibly fast start! Solved the main problem is frustrating me.
Title: Re: v0.8.55 - Faster Startup
Post by: smokim11 on December 24, 2013, 10:56:17 pm
Freetrade not sure but I think the first link is the old wallet.

The Google link good.
Title: Re: v0.8.55 - Faster Startup
Post by: Delinquency on December 24, 2013, 11:18:33 pm
Freetrade not sure but I think the first link is the old wallet.

The Google link good.

Outstanding job on the fast startup time!
Title: Re: v0.8.55 - Faster Startup
Post by: jorneyflair on December 25, 2013, 02:32:55 am
excellent work :) open and resync in 3sec
Title: Re: v0.8.55 - Faster Startup
Post by: hayer on December 25, 2013, 12:18:13 pm
Hi,

I'm running solo miner on verson v0.8.54. Have prolem with that when I run old verion.

Thanks.
Title: Re: v0.8.55 - Faster Startup
Post by: Grekk on December 25, 2013, 04:13:37 pm
FreeTrade
I am solo mine about 25 xeon machines to 1 wallet.dat. Can i problem with that?
May be better to use different wallet.dat on each machine?
Thanks.
Title: Re: v0.8.55 - Faster Startup
Post by: danbi on December 25, 2013, 09:22:54 pm
Software compiled from source.  With

cd src
gmake -f makefile.unix

When run for the first time, it downloads the block chain, and "works". But restarting it always dumps core.
Deleting the block chain and leaving only the wallet -- works again, then after restart it is dumping core again.
Seems it is not liking it's on disk block chain. :)

If a strack trace helps:

(gdb) bt
#0  0x0000000800fb8779 in std::string::assign (this=<value optimized out>,
    __str=<value optimized out>) from /usr/local/lib/gcc46/libstdc++.so.6
#1  0x000000000047d952 in CBlockHeader::GetHash (this=0x7fffffffbf80)
    at error_code.hpp:499
#2  0x00000000005811fd in CBlockTreeDB::LoadBlockIndexGuts (
    this=<value optimized out>) at error_code.hpp:499
#3  0x000000000047c34a in LoadBlockIndexDB () at error_code.hpp:499
#4  0x000000000047cb2f in LoadBlockIndex () at error_code.hpp:499
#5  0x0000000801c62b18 in ?? ()
#6  0xdd6f08c5dbd62905 in ?? ()
#7  0x0000000804e59e80 in ?? ()
#8  0x000001432ba19a7c in ?? ()
#9  0x0000000000000048 in ?? () at error_code.hpp:184
#10 0x0000000800fcf1cd in operator new (sz=140737488341456)
    at ../../.././../gcc-4.6.4/libstdc++-v3/libsupc++/new_op.cc:52
#11 0x0000000000447aa1 in AppInit2 (threadGroup=@0x7fffffffd5e0)
    at error_code.hpp:499
#12 0x00007fffffffc400 in ?? ()
#13 0x0000000800aeab6b in r_debug_state () from /libexec/ld-elf.so.1
Previous frame inner to this frame (corrupt stack?)

tried few different compilers, same result. Also, why is it producing bitcoind excitable? :)
Title: Re: v0.8.55 - Faster Startup
Post by: hayer on December 26, 2013, 01:08:40 am
Sometime Miner crash .I dont know why I have to restart it. I Use Ubuntu and Debian .Event I upgrade to new verion , Still crash.

Title: Re: v0.8.55 - Faster Startup
Post by: 3dtr on December 30, 2013, 04:41:59 pm
Download now. My hashes are:

sha256: 3ec3bbb173b95b740f79baf28b286f978a8b243cb16062c1caa1a76d95ad6e13
sha1: 17bedb17f61b8fc403764ddb2cb1be5af31e96ee
md5: 49f790d969d290a8f23ab59caffeb3c3

Are they ok?